Process Engineering Positions

Placon Corporation

We're looking for a dependable Process Engineer who will be located in our Madison, WI facility that thrives in a fast‑paced GMP manufacturing environment and takes pride in developing reliable processes, supporting new product development, and driving continuous improvement. If you have strong analytical skills, mechanical understanding, and a passion for improving manufacturing performance, this is a great opportunity to make an impact.

Compensation

Commensurate with experience, the range is $70,000 - 85,000 annually.

Work Schedule

Onsite: 8 AM - 5 PM | Monday - Friday

What You’ll Do

Devise and execute plans to qualify new products and materials

Support capital equipment projects by becoming an onsite expert in process and equipment

Improve production efficiency by analyzing process control trends and troubleshooting issues

Use Lean, Six Sigma, and other tools to identify and implement continuous improvement opportunities

Collect and analyze data; present recommendations through formal reports and presentations

Coordinate with planning and design teams to ensure product and tooling deadlines are met

Construct and maintain technical documents, specifications, and data sheets

Establish and review product standards for material, labor, and equipment

Maintain understanding of ISO quality systems as they relate to process development

Write proposals for capital expenditures and obtain approval

What You Bring

Bachelor of Science in Chemical, Materials, Mechanical, or related engineering field

Excellent written and verbal communication skills

Strong cross‑functional teamwork and project management abilities

Technical competency in polymer materials, processing, and testing

Understanding statistical analysis and process capability

Strong problem‑solving and troubleshooting skills

Experience in a manufacturing environment with knowledge of machine components and equipment

Ability to learn and utilize ERP and QMS systems

Knowledge of Lean, Six Sigma, and modern manufacturing methods

Ability to lift 10-50 lbs., stand for long periods, and travel as needed

Self‑starter mindset with strong organization, time management, and attention to detail
